ZIP code 91356 is a densely settled ZIP (a standard USPS delivery area) in Tarzana, Los Angeles County, California, with 29,458 residents across 19.0 square miles, a density of 1,551 people per square mile, in the Los Angeles time zone.

ZIP 91356 lands in the middle-income range, with a median household income of $107,378 (6% above the average California ZIP), while per-capita income is $69,553. The poverty rate is 9.2%, with unemployment at 5.6%; those measures add context to the income figure. Median home value is $1,229,000 (59% above the average California ZIP) and median rent is $2,009; 58.0% of occupied homes are owner-occupied.

This is a highly-educated ZIP: 55.8%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, the median age is 42.3, and the average commute is 32 minutes. What businesses operate in this ZIP?

Census Bureau data shows 1,873 business establishments in ZIP 91356, employing approximately 12,944 people with a combined annual payroll of $728,331,000.

How have home values changed in ZIP code 91356?

According to the FHFA House Price Index, home values in ZIP 91356 increased by 7.6% in 2024. Since 2000, home values in this ZIP have appreciated by approximately 275%. This is a developmental index based on repeat sales and appraisal data from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ac.
